Discover Tillandsia 'Silver Queen', a majestic hybrid airplant that truly lives up to its noble name.

Parentage: Tillandsia jalisco-monticola × Tillandsia xerographica
Distinctive traits: Combines the elegant form of T. jalisco-monticola with the impressive size of T. xerographica
Availability: Rare and highly sought-after hybrid, prized by serious collectors

Key features:

  • Stunning size: Can grow very large, with flowering specimens reaching up to 75cm high
  • Elegant foliage: Long, flowing white leaves create a cascading, sculptural form
  • Spectacular blooms: Produces a tall, branched inflorescence with vibrant colors
  • Regal presence: Commanding appearance makes it a showstopping centerpiece
  • Botanical intrigue: Also reported as a possible natural hybrid, adding to its allure

Appearance: 'Silver Queen' forms an impressive rosette of long, silvery-white leaves that flow and curl elegantly. The foliage creates a fountain-like silhouette reminiscent of a royal crown. When in bloom, it produces a tall, branching inflorescence that towers above the plant, decorated with brightly colored flowers.

Collector's Note: This hybrid, registered by John Arden in 1987, represents the pinnacle of Tillandsia breeding. Its potential status as both a cultivated and natural hybrid adds an element of mystery to its origins. 'Silver Queen' offers collectors a chance to grow one of the most spectacular Tillandsia hybrids in existence.

Care tip: Provide bright, indirect light to maintain its silvery coloration. Water 2-3 times a week by misting thoroughly or soaking for 30-45 minutes, ensuring the plant dries completely within 4-6 hours. Due to its large size, it may require more frequent watering than smaller Tillandsia. Excellent air circulation is crucial.
